How to Build an Octagonal Garden Greenhouse

This step by step tutorial of how to build an octagonal garden greenhouse is a great way to jump start or expand your growing season by capturing the sun’s heat inside a structure. Building your own small greenhouse is great use of vertical space for homesteaders that don’t have the largest backyards or for those that want to keep to a small budget.

You can find most of what you need at your local hardware store or even through recycled materials someone no longer wants, such as wood from old decks or fencing. With these materials in hand, you’ll have your plant’s new home built in no time at all.

The diameter from corner to corner is 6′ 2 1/2″ and the distance from the edges on parallel sides is 5′ 8 13/16″. The total width of each outer wall is 28 1/2″.
